mysql模型怎么导出

mysql模型怎么导出

扫码添加渲大师小管家,免费领取渲染插件、素材、模型、教程合集大礼包!

mysql模型怎么导出

当需要在 MySQL 数据库中导出数据或模型时,正确的方法至关重要,以确保数据的完整性和安全性。本文将详细介绍如何利用 MySQL 导出工具实现数据模型的导出,以及一些关键的操作步骤。

导出 MySQL 数据模型的基本方法是使用 MySQL 自带的命令行工具或者图形化管理工具。其中,最常用的命令是 `mysqldump`。这个工具能够将整个数据库或者指定的表导出为 SQL 脚本文件,保留了数据库结构、表结构以及表中的数据。例如,要导出名为 `mydatabase` 的数据库,可以使用以下命令:

mysqldump -u username -p mydatabase > mydatabase_backup.sql

在这个命令中,`-u` 用来指定数据库用户名,`-p` 提示系统询问密码,并将数据库导出到名为 `mydatabase_backup.sql` 的 SQL 文件中。这个文件包含了数据库的所有结构和数据,是将数据库迁移到其他服务器或备份的理想选择。

对于大型数据库或需要定期备份的情况,可以通过设置定时任务来自动化导出过程,以确保数据的实时性和安全性。例如,使用操作系统的定时任务工具(如 cron)来定期执行导出命令,保持备份文件的更新和完整性。

除了使用命令行工具外,还可以考虑使用图形化管理工具,如 MySQL Workbench 或 Navicat 等,这些工具提供了直观的用户界面来执行数据库导出操作,并允许用户选择导出的范围和格式。这对于不熟悉命令行操作的用户来说尤为方便,能够通过简单的点击完成复杂的数据库导出任务。

MySQL 数据模型的导出是数据库管理中重要的一环,它不仅能够保证数据的安全备份,还能够支持数据库的迁移和复原操作。通过合理选择导出工具和定期执行备份策略,可以有效地提高数据库管理的效率和可靠性,确保业务数据在任何情况下都能够得到有效的保护和利用。

navicat 导出表结构

Navicat 是一款功能强大的数据库管理工具,提供了丰富的功能来帮助用户管理和操作数据库。其中,导出表结构是其重要功能之一,本文将详细介绍如何使用 Navicat 导出表结构,并讨论其在数据库管理中的重要性。

使用 Navicat 导出表结构非常简便。用户只需打开 Navicat,连接到目标数据库,选择目标表,然后右键点击该表,在菜单中选择“导出表结构”。Navicat 将会生成一个包含表结构定义的 SQL 脚本文件,该文件包括表的各个字段、主键、外键以及约束条件等详细信息。这个功能对于数据库管理员和开发人员来说尤为重要,因为他们可以利用这个脚本文件来备份表结构、在不同环境之间同步表结构,或者进行数据库迁移。

导出表结构不仅仅是简单的备份和同步,它还有助于数据库的版本控制和团队协作。通过将表结构导出为 SQL 脚本文件,团队成员可以很容易地查看和理解数据库的结构定义,从而更好地进行数据库开发和维护工作。这些脚本文件可以作为文档的一部分,帮助团队成员了解数据库的设计和演变历史,确保开发过程中的一致性和可维护性。

Navicat 提供的导出表结构功能不仅仅是一个工具功能,它背后承载了数据库管理中重要的备份、同步、版本控制和团队协作的角色。通过简单的几步操作,用户可以轻松获取和管理数据库表的结构定义,确保数据库的稳定性和可维护性。无论是对于个人开发者还是大型团队,Navicat 的这一功能都显得尤为重要和实用。

mysql导出整个数据库

MySQL是一种流行的关系型数据库管理系统,广泛应用于各种Web应用程序和数据驱动的应用程序中。在数据库管理过程中,导出整个数据库是一项关键任务,有时需要将数据库备份或迁移至其他环境。以下是如何使用MySQL导出整个数据库的方法。

为了导出整个MySQL数据库,我们可以使用命令行工具或图形用户界面(GUI)工具。在命令行中,可以使用mysqldump命令。这是一个非常强大的工具,能够以多种格式导出数据库,包括SQL文件。例如,要导出名为mydatabase的整个数据库,可以执行以下命令:

mysqldump -u username -p mydatabase > mydatabase.sql

这条命令将会提示输入密码,然后将mydatabase数据库的结构和数据导出到一个名为mydatabase.sql的SQL文件中。这个文件可以随时用于数据库恢复或在其他MySQL服务器上导入。

总结使用mysqldump命令是导出整个MySQL数据库的ultimate方法。它不仅可以快速高效地备份数据库,还能确保导出的数据完整性和一致性。无论是在开发、还是生产环境中,定期备份数据库是确保数据安全和可靠性的重要步骤。

mysql主要索引类型

MySQL中的索引是提高数据库查询效率的重要手段之一,不同类型的索引适用于不同的查询需求和数据特征。主要的索引类型包括:B树索引、哈希索引和全文索引。

B树索引是MySQL中最常见的索引类型,它适用于范围查找和排序查询。B树索引通过平衡树结构(通常是B+树)来存储索引数据,保证每个节点的子节点数在一个范围内,从而确保查询的高效性。这种索引适合于频繁需要按范围查询的情况,如区间查询、排序操作等。

哈希索引则通过哈希表来实现,适用于等值查找的场景。哈希索引能够快速定位到具体的行,适合于单一唯一值的查询,例如根据主键进行快速检索。相较于B树索引,哈希索引在范围查找和排序上的性能表现通常较差。

全文索引则用于对文本内容进行搜索,这在需要对大段文本或者长文本字段进行全文检索时非常有用。MySQL的全文索引基于特定的全文搜索引擎,支持对文本进行自然语言的全文检索,如通过MATCH AGAINST语法进行复杂的文本查询。

MySQL中的索引类型各有其特点和适用场景。选择合适的索引类型可以显著提升数据库的查询性能和效率,但也需要根据具体的查询需求和数据特征来进行权衡和选择。

分享到 :
相关推荐

驱动更新软件哪个好(驱动更新软件哪个好一点)

1、驱动更新软件哪个好驱动更新是电脑维护的重要环节,它能保证计算机硬件的正常运作。[...

java泛型类的定义和使用(java 获取泛型T的class)

1、java泛型类的定义和使用Java泛型类是Java语言中的一个重要特性,能够让[...

硬盘低格工具哪个好

大家好,今天来介绍硬盘低格工具哪个好(低级格式化工具有哪些功能)的问题,以下是渲大师...

裸金属服务器为什么叫裸金属

裸金属服务器为什么叫裸金属裸金属服务器(BareMetalServer)是一种[&h...

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注